I strongly encourage clients to spend 10-15 minutes each day to monitor their social media accounts. This can be challenging if you don’t stay focused. It’s so easy to get distracted by what’s going on in social media and especially in your personal timeline on Facebook. Stay focused on your purpose to monitor your business accounts and be determined not to get sidetracked.
You can do it! I’ve timed myself more than once and I spend 10-15 minutes every morning doing this focused daily monitoring on my social media for business accounts. Later in the day I can spend time on my personal accounts.
My Daily Monitoring Routine
I did all this today in just under 9 minutes:
- Log in to Instagram to check my business account
- Check notifications – new likes, comments, messages, new followers
- Respond to any comments, messages, new followers
- Review and like a few appropriate posts by others
- Log in to LinkedIn
- Check notifications & messages
- Respond to any comments, messages, new network connections
- Review and like a few appropriate posts by others
- Log in to Twitter
- Check notifications & messages
- Follow back as appropriate anyone new who has followed me
- Follow at least 5 new profiles
- Respond to any comments, messages
- Check my lists and like and retweet a few appropriate tweets by others
- Log in to Facebook to check my business account
- Check notifications & messages
- Respond to any comments, messages, new connections
- Review and like a few appropriate posts by others
The process usually does only take me about 10 minutes each morning. Sometimes a bit longer if there are comments on articles I’ve posted or group discussions I’m participating in.
For each account, I check only my business accounts. I check my personal accounts later in the day.
